I'm going on my first safari in September and i have thought about taking a action camera. I have a go-pro but its so wide angled that everything in video looks 3 times as far as it really is. Do you recommend any kind of camera that can be strapped to yourself like the go-pro.

I've been researching the same thing and have found there are many options out there depending on what angles/shots you really want to take. For my bow, I found a mount that works for my cell phone, so I can video on the spot and stalk and at the shot. There is the Sony action camera, but a few companies make head mounts for small HD camcorders so you have that option, too. One of the best camcorders reviewed for this year was the Panasonic at about $300. Small and great HD video, even in low light conditions. Something hunters like us find appealing.
 
I have used a Contour and found it good to use. You can get all sorts of mounts and the new model one I have has GPS tracking on it so you can see your altitude and location as you watch the video. Its small and handy and simple to use.
